Severe Weather Possible from Tenn. Valley to New England

The NWS Storm Prediction Center is forecasting a risk of severe thunderstorms Wednesday afternoon and evening across parts of the Tennessee Valley northeastward across the lower Great Lakes and into New England. The main threats will be damaging winds and large hail, especially across the lower Great Lakes region.
